26/01393/TCA - Works to Trees - Conservation Area Approved

Proposal

Remove torn branches and raise crown to 6m of group of coppiced trees (G1), reduce back lower branches from house by approx. 2-3m of 1no Goat Willow (T1), cut to stump 1no Goat Willow (T2) & remove smallest stem of 1no Sycamore (T4) within Tankerville Conservation Area… Data via plota.co.uk
